    Max Kane: The "Killer's Kid" Finding His Voice

    Max Kane, narrating the story, initially presents himself as a "dumb lug," a perception reinforced by societal labeling. He's haunted by his father's past, labeled the "killer's kid," and struggles with self-esteem and a sense of insignificance. He internalizes the negative judgments of others, believing himself to be inherently flawed.

    • The Weight of Inheritance: Max's father's incarceration casts a long shadow, shaping his social interactions and self-image. He carries the weight of societal prejudice, constantly anticipating rejection and misunderstanding. This internalized stigma significantly impacts his self-worth and his ability to form healthy relationships.

    • Finding Strength in Friendship: His friendship with Kevin, however, becomes a catalyst for his personal transformation. Kevin's intelligence and confidence counter Max's self-doubt, enabling him to discover his own strengths and abilities. Through Kevin, Max learns to value himself and to challenge the limiting beliefs imposed upon him by others.

    • Growth and Self-Discovery: Throughout the novel, Max evolves from a shy, withdrawn individual to a confident and compassionate young man. He learns to articulate his thoughts and feelings, finding his voice not only through narration but also through his actions. His journey reflects a powerful message about the resilience of the human spirit and the transformative power of friendship.

    The Significance of Names and Nicknames

    The names and nicknames used in the novel are carefully chosen and contribute significantly to character development. "Killer's Kid" for Max reflects societal prejudice. "Freak" for Kevin, while initially derogatory, eventually transforms into a term of endearment that reflects his extraordinary nature. These names reveal much about societal perceptions and individual resilience.
